Postsecondary Law Teacher Salary in Jacksonville, Florida

The annual salary statistics of postsecondary law teachers in Jacksonville, Florida is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of postsecondary law teachers in Jacksonville is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Postsecondary Law Teachers in Jacksonville, Florida

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$83,110
25th Percentile Wage
$86,700
50th Percentile Wage
$92,700
75th Percentile Wage
$98,700
90th Percentile Wage
$102,300

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for postsecondary law teachers in Jacksonville, Florida in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$102,300.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$92,700.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$83,110.

Table 2. Compare Postsecondary Law Teacher Salary in Jacksonville with Other Florida Cities

From Table 3 we note that with a median annual salary of $92,700, Jacksonville is the lowest paying city for postsecondary law teachers in state of Florida, following city of Tampa-St Petersburg-Clearwater (median annual salary of $166,900). Also we note that in comparison, the annual salary of postsecondary law teachers in Jacksonville is about 44.5 percent (44.5%) lower than that of the highest paying city Tampa-St Petersburg-Clearwater.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Tampa-St Petersburg-Clearwater
$166,900
Tallahassee
$164,860
Miami-Miami Beach-Kendall
$140,180
Fort Lauderdale-Pompano Beach-Deerfield Beach
$112,750
Orlando-Kissimmee-Sanford
$105,640
Miami-Fort Lauderdale-Pompano Beach
$105,080
Jacksonville
$92,700
